THE CHIEF Executive Officer of the Ghana Free Zones Authority (GFZA), Dr. Mary Awusi, has hosted the Chief Executive Officer of Ghana National Gas Limited Company (Ghana Gas), Ms. Judith Adjoba Blay, during a courtesy call aimed at strengthening cooperation between the two institutions.

The visit formed part of efforts to deepen collaboration in support of Ghana’s industrialisation and energy development agenda.
Speaking after the engagement, Dr. Awusi said the discussions centred on the critical role of natural gas infrastructure in driving industrial growth and supporting economic development within the country’s Free Zones enclaves.
According to her, Ghana Gas currently operates natural gas transmission pipelines within the Tema Export Processing Zone and the Sekondi Industrial Park to facilitate the supply of gas for power generation and industrial activities.

She noted that both institutions explored opportunities to enhance cooperation in order to improve energy reliability, support existing and prospective industries within the Free Zones industrial enclaves, and promote future infrastructure development.
The meeting, she added, reaffirmed the commitment of both institutions to building strategic partnerships aimed at boosting industrial productivity, strengthening energy security, and promoting sustainable economic growth in the country.
